Wine, food festival seminars planned
Post on 03-03-2007.
Montana State University-Billings Foundation's Wine & Food Festival will host two Wine 101 seminars from 7 to 10 p.m. Tuesday and Wednesday in the MSU-Billings Student Union Ballroom.
Guests will learn the basics of wines and will enjoy the art of wine-tasting by sampling one number of fine wines and one variety of foods to experience the pleasure of appropriate pairings. ...

Burgundy on the QEW
Post on 03-03-2007.
Last week I enthused about an Ontario red from Southbrook Winery that vanquished the likes of Château Lafite-Rothschild and several other illustrious Bordeaux in one blind tasting. This week, the domestic wine pride gets another big boost with the LCBO release of one line of premium pinot noirs and chardonnays that have been causing one sensation among Ontario wine-trade insiders. ...
